WebMar 1, 2024 · Hartland Heritage Coast. This coastal stretch of 60 miles straddles the border of Cornwall into Devon. The region is filled with cliffs and winding paths that lead … WebOutstanding Natural Beauty and Hartland heritage coast. Hartland, Clovelly and Bucks Mills are Conservation Areas and there are Scheduled Monuments sparsely spread along the coast including hill forts and earthworks. This largely undefended coast is at very little risk of erosion or flooding. The plan for the long term is
